Universal adds ‘Insidious’ to Halloween Horror Nights lineup

Artwork for the "Insidious: The Further" haunted house coming to Halloween Horror Nights. (Universal)

Universal has added “Insidious: The Further” to the lineup for this year’s Halloween Horror Nights, which kicks off at Universal Studios Florida on Aug. 30. 

Based on the “Insidious” film franchise, the all-new haunted house will feature a storyline center around the Lamberts, a family haunted by evil supernatural forces. 

“Guests will follow in the footsteps of the Lamberts, encountering familiar settings and scares as they were transported directly into ‘The Further’—the ethereal place where ghosts and demons lurk,” Universal described in a news release. 

As visitors make their way through the house, traveling from red door to red door, they will encounter demons and spirits from the franchise, including The Red-Faced Demon, KeyFace, the Bride in Black and the Man Who Can’t Breathe. 

Universal Studios Hollywood will also get a version of the “Insidious” house for its HHN event. 

“Insidious: The Further” joins the previously announced houses for “Ghostbusters: Frozen Empire” and “A Quiet Place.” Orlando will also have several original concept houses, including Slaughter Sinema 2, Major Sweets Candy Factory and Goblin’s Feast. 

Halloween Horror Nights will feature 10 haunted houses, five scare zones, live entertainment and themed food and beverage. 

The after-hours event will run select nights through Nov. 3.
